#ifndef RECONSTRUCTION_BACKEND_HPP
#define RECONSTRUCTION_BACKEND_HPP
#include <vector>
#include <string>
#include "qcl.hpp"
#include "cl_types.hpp"
#include "particle_grid.hpp"
#include "async_io.hpp"
namespace illcrawl {
class reconstruction_backend
{
public:
using particle = device_vector4;
virtual std::vector<H5::DataSet> get_required_additional_datasets() const = 0;
virtual const cl::Buffer& retrieve_results() = 0;
virtual std::string get_backend_name() const = 0;
virtual void init_backend(std::size_t blocksize) = 0;
virtual void setup_particles(const std::vector<particle>& particles,
const std::vector<cl::Buffer>& additional_dataset) = 0;
virtual void setup_evaluation_points(const cl::Buffer& evaluation_points,
std::size_t num_points) = 0;
virtual void run() = 0;
virtual ~reconstruction_backend(){}
};
}
#endif
